The 2018 Cabernet Sauvignon Beckstoffer To Kalon Vineyard The Three Kings comes from a single parcel in this great vineyard and is all Clone 7 Cabernet Sauvignon. Incredible dark fruits, graphite, iron, spice box, and an undeniable sense of minerality define the aromatics, and it’s a full-bodied, powerful, even opulent 2018 that has the vintage’s pure, focused, precise style front and center. Its balance is spot on, and given its structure and purity, it’s going to evolve for another 30 years or more.

Mark Carter's 2018 Cabernet Sauvignon Beckstoffer To Kalon Vineyard The Three Kings is a huge, powerful wine. Inky dark fruit, chocolate, spice, new leather, licorice and cloves saturate the palate in a dense, brooding Cabernet that will need time to come into its own.
Deep garnet-purple in color, the 2018 Cabernet Sauvignon Beckstoffer To Kalon The Three Kings opens with bold, expressive scents of fresh red and black plums, black raspberries, redcurrants and dried Mediterranean herbs with hints of pencil lead, damp soil and tree bark. Medium to full-bodied, the palate is chock-full of lively red and black berry flavors, supported by grainy tannins and just enough freshness, finishing with a peppery kick.
